About EC1A 9HG: area rating, property, schools and local change

EC1A 9HG is a postcode in Clerkenwell, Islington, London, England. This postcode area guide brings together crime, schools, demographics, property prices, planning applications, HMO licences and roadworks near EC1A 9HG, then scores the surrounding small area 58/100 - top 44% nationally across 8 matched LocaleIQ domains.

The strongest signals around EC1A 9HG are local prosperity and housing, while safety is the main area to examine before moving, renting or buying here. LocaleIQ uses these local signals as a practical area rating rather than a single raw statistic, so read the score alongside the detailed map layers and source records.

The demographic profile for EC1A 9HG is based on City of London 001 Census 2021. It covers 8,579 residents, 2,975 people per square kilometre. The median age is around 37, helping show whether the area skews younger, family-sized or older. Housing tenure is 37% owner-occupied, 48% privately rented, 15% social rented, useful context for renters, buyers and landlords comparing the local property market. On the official England neighbourhood wellbeing index the area ranks in decile 8/10.

For property prices near EC1A 9HG, LocaleIQ uses Land Registry sold-price evidence for the EC1A postcode district. The latest median sold price is £540k from 4 rolling sales. The Property tab separates flats, terraced, semi-detached and detached homes where enough sales exist.

Families checking schools near EC1A 9HG can compare 12 state schools within one mile, including 6 rated Good or Outstanding by Ofsted or the equivalent inspectorate. The Schools tab adds phase, school type, distance, rating and a dedicated school map so the education context is easier to judge.
